"""
|
|
Fast Array Sum using Shared Memory - Two-Stage Reduction
|
|
|
|
Demonstrates efficient parallel reduction using shared memory and
|
|
two-stage approach to avoid atomic operation bottlenecks.
|
|
|
|
Key Features:
|
|
- Block-level reduction using shared memory
|
|
- Each thread loads 2 elements to reduce global memory traffic
|
|
- Sequential addressing tree reduction pattern
|
|
- No atomic operations - eliminates serialization bottleneck
|
|
- Device memory via CuPy; ``launch()`` takes pointers as ``ndarray.data.ptr``
|
|
- CuPy uses ``cp.cuda.Stream.from_external(stream)``.
|
|
"""

# Two-stage block reduction kernel
|
|
REDUCTION_KERNEL = """
|
|
/*
|
|
* Block-level reduction kernel using shared memory
|
|
*
|
|
* Strategy:
|
|
* - Each block processes blockSize * 2 elements
|
|
* - Uses shared memory for fast intra-block reduction
|
|
* - Outputs one partial sum per block (no atomics)
|
|
*
|
|
* Key optimizations:
|
|
* - Load 2 elements per thread (reduces global memory traffic by 50%)
|
|
* - Tree reduction with sequential addressing (avoids divergence)
|
|
* - Shared memory instead of atomic operations (eliminates bottleneck)
|
|
*
|
|
* Note: This sample provides separate implementations for each data type
|
|
* for clarity. Production code typically uses templates with SharedMemory<T>
|
|
* or reinterpret_cast to avoid duplication. See NVIDIA reduction guide for
|
|
* template-based approaches.
|
|
*/
|
|
|
|
extern "C" __global__ void blockReduceKernel_int(
|
|
const int *__restrict__ input,
|
|
int *__restrict__ blockSums,
|
|
unsigned int n)
|
|
{
|
|
extern __shared__ int sdata_int[];
|
|
|
|
unsigned int tid = threadIdx.x;
|
|
unsigned int blockSize = blockDim.x;
|
|
unsigned int gid = blockIdx.x * (blockSize * 2) + tid;
|
|
|
|
// Load 2 elements per thread
|
|
int sum = 0;
|
|
if (gid < n) sum += input[gid];
|
|
if (gid + blockSize < n) sum += input[gid + blockSize];
|
|
|
|
sdata_int[tid] = sum;
|
|
__syncthreads();
|
|
|
|
// Tree reduction with sequential addressing
|
|
for (unsigned int s = blockSize / 2; s > 0; s >>= 1) {
|
|
if (tid < s) {
|
|
sdata_int[tid] += sdata_int[tid + s];
|
|
}
|
|
__syncthreads();
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
// Write block result
|
|
if (tid == 0) {
|
|
blockSums[blockIdx.x] = sdata_int[0];
|
|
}
|
|
}
